Short history of this plane until having the colors and winglets:
During October 2008 it was ferried in Air Bashkortostan colors (ex EI-LTO) from DME (Moscow, Russia) to NWI (Norwich, England), via MUC, GVA (Geneva, Switzerland) and MSE (Kent, England), where it was repainted to Gainjet's colors. It was then ferried back to MUC in order to have it's blended winglets installed. By mid-November it was ready and it is parked there since then.
